Agile. Creative. Innovative. And yes, strategic, too.

The demands on today’s chief operating officers go far beyond optimizing resources and efficiencies. Successful COOs must also encourage and implement organizational change and create a culture that accelerates innovation. This three-module program will give you the strategies and leadership skills to innovate, collaborate, and execute. Details on the modules can be found at the bottom of the page.

Key Benefits

  • Learn to achieve operational excellence, instill and inspire innovation, and foster collaboration across your organization.
  • Develop strategic thinking and frameworks to achieve operational excellence.
  • Learn design thinking methodology and mindsets to lead operational innovation.
  • Explore how to integrate effective new operational routines into your organization’s culture.
  • Enhance communication and leadership skills to get buy-in at the C-suite level and across the organization.
  • Network with peers from diverse industries and functional areas to gain new insights that can be applied to your organization.
